1 d
Spark bigquery connector?
Follow
11
Spark bigquery connector?
py with touch wordcount. In Scala, for the time being, job body is the following: val events: RDD[RichTrackEvent] =. Now you can use all of your custom filters, gestures, smart notifications on your laptop or des. Jul 9, 2024 · The spark-bigquery-connector is used with Apache Spark to read and write data from and to BigQuery. Facing Issue while using Spark-BigQuery-Connector with Java. 83TB table in BigQuery. All reactions Currently we are using following code to write spark dataframe to BigQuery: outDFformat("bigquery"). However, you can query it and load the data into a dataframe in the following manner: Running a Spark job in Google Cloud Dataproc. properties, to mount the BigQuery connector as the example catalog. cost_center", "analytics") sparkset("bigQueryJobLabel. Hi, I want to play a little bit with the BigQuery connector (on AWS EMR version 51 with Spark 22) and run this command: pyspark --packages comcloud. 292-b10, mixed mode) If you have higher version of Java, Spark connector to BigQuery will fail. Code; Issues 23; Pull requests 6; Actions; Projects 0; Security; Insights New issue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and. 0), but when trying to read I'm getting the following error: spark format("bigquery") This is the last version of the Spark BigQuery connector for scala 2 The code will remain in the repository and\ncan be compiled into a connector if needed. 3-bigquery to the spark. Please use the spark-2. Please use the spark-2. Dec 17, 2021 · Caused by: comcloudbigquerycomcloudBigQueryException: Provided Schema does not match Table xyz$20211115. But the only JDBC driver I found starschema is old The pom. Notifications You must be signed in to change notification settings; Fork 189; Star 358. Jul 9, 2024 · The spark-bigquery-connector is used with Apache Spark to read and write data from and to BigQuery. Garden hose connectors — also known as hose fittings — are a key component of any lawn or garden watering system. Notifications You must be signed in to change notification settings; Fork 190; Star 353. We tried to exclude slf4j dependency from arrow-vector , build it and try customized jar. If you see the below logs, its able to identify the schema of the table and after that it waited for 8. PR #1122: Set traceId on write. BigQuery data source for Apache Spark: Read data from BigQuery into DataFrames, write DataFrames into BigQuery tables. This means that while writing and reading of maps is available, running a SQL on BigQuery that uses map semantics is not supported. The Hive execution engine handles compute operations, such as aggregates and joins, and the connector manages interactions with data stored in BigQuery or in BigLake-connected Cloud Storage buckets. Have you ever found yourself staring at a blank page, unsure of where to begin? Whether you’re a writer, artist, or designer, the struggle to find inspiration can be all too real Young Adult (YA) novels have become a powerful force in literature, captivating readers of all ages with their compelling stories and relatable characters. Is there an expected date for this feature? We found that we have extra slf4j dependency in the bigquery connector dependency tree in Bigquery Connector version: 00. When the spark does type does not match exactly to the BigQuery type, it does not push the predicate down to the connector, which results in a larger read. BigQuery Standard-SQL data types documentation states the A. Using the BigQuery Connector to load json data output from the job into a BigQuery table. cost_center", "analytics") sparkset("bigQueryJobLabel. 5-bigquery aimed to be used in Spark 3 This connector implements new APIs and capabilities provided by the Spark Data Source V2 API. In this article: Permissions. keyfile properties, because they override --service-account setting with custom key files If you will drop these properties, then it will work as you expect, at least on GCS connector side. Laptop screens and motherboards are connected by a single c. If this case is relevant for you, please check BigQuery's JDBC driver for easier integration with spark. Here is my code: spark = SparkSessionappName("test") I have create a client id and client secret for my bigquery project, but I don't know how to use those to successfully save a dataframe from a pyspark script to my bigquery table GoogleCloudDataproc / spark-bigquery-connector Public Notifications Fork 189 Star 358 196 Apr 19, 2023 at 19:57 apache-spark pyspark google-bigquery google-cloud-storage spark-bigquery-connector 2,986 Feb 21, 2023 at 16:16 apache-spark spark-bigquery-connector 24 Jan 25, 2023 at 18:22 apache-spark pyspark google-bigquery spark-bigquery-connector 39 Jan 21, 2023 at 21:28 json pyspark google-bigquery apache-spark-sql spark. spark:spark-bigquery-with-dependencies_2. Compare to other cards and apply online in seconds We're sorry, but the Capital One® Spark®. show () fails) #225 Closed informatica92 opened this issue on Jul 31, 2020 · 15 comments informatica92 commented on Jul 31, 2020 • I'm writing a Spark job in Scala on Google DataProc that executes daily and processes records each marked with a transaction time. Each spark plug has an O-ring that prevents oil leaks In today’s fast-paced digital world, having a stable and reliable internet connection is essential. The latest version of the spark-bigquery connector should be used to establish a reliable and high-performance connection between AWS Glue. Notifications You must be signed in to change notification settings; Fork 189; Star 358. 1" scalaVersion := "212" val sparkVersion = "20" conflictManager := ConflictManager. Taken from the GCFS spark example docs here In this method the data is written directly to BigQuery using the BigQuery Storage Write API Here is the spark session I am making. davidrabinowitz closed this as completed on Jun 24, 2022 davidrabinowitz. Viewed 978 times Part of Google Cloud Collective 4 I have developed a Scala Spark application for streaming data directly into Google BigQuery, using the spark-bigquery connector by Spotify GoogleCloudDataproc / spark-bigquery-connector Public. I am able to read small tables using the same connector. Apache Spark SQL connector for Google BigQuery The connector supports reading Google BigQuery tables into Spark's DataFrames, and writing DataFrames back into BigQuery. The connector is publicly hosted, so we will add it using the JARS environment variable. This had no impact on the actual logic, just on the log. jars configuration): sparkformat("comcloudbigquerySpark33BigQueryTableProvider") Configuring BigQuery connections To connect to Google BigQuery from AWS Glue, you will need to create and store your Google Cloud Platform credentials in a AWS Secrets Manager secret, then associate that secret with a Google BigQuery AWS Glue connection. Notifications You must be signed in to change notification settings; Fork 189; Star 358. Code; Issues 53; Pull requests 15; Actions; Projects 0; Security; Insights; New issue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community The cause was that the column name contained " Therefore, it was solved by replacing " mizue31g closed this as completed Aug 28, 2023. \n
can you listen to 911 calls online iowa If this case is relevant for you, please check BigQuery's JDBC driver for easier integration with spark. davidrabinowitz closed this as completed on Jun 24, 2022 davidrabinowitz. Cumbers has an ongoing window into the future of synthetic biology. Adding labels to the jobs is done in the following manner: sparkset("bigQueryJobLabel. It will use pyspark for preprocessing and then writes the result dataframe into BigQuery. Parent project (parentProject): The ID for the parent project, which is the Google Cloud Project ID to bill for reading and writing. py with touch wordcount. As the spark-bigquery-connector does not depend directly on the GCS connector, what needs to be done is to install the new GCS connector (23) on your cluster, or launch a new Dataproc cluster with the --metadata GCS_CONNECTOR_VERSION=23 flag I'm keeping this bug open to track this issue and verify that this. json and put it inside the. The BigQuery Query API requires a Google Cloud Storage location to unload data into before reading it into Apache Spark Can't show dataframe (df. Right now, two of the most popular opt. To read from BigQuery, we need to use one Java library: spark-bigquery. This means that while writing and reading of maps is available, running a SQL on BigQuery that uses map semantics is not supported. Objectives Use linear regression to build a model of birth weight as a function of five factors: Apart from native integration with Google Cloud Services, it also offers 150+ pre-configured connectors and transformations at zero additional cost Google Cloud Integration: Simplifies security and enables fast data analysis with tools like Cloud Storage, Dataproc, BigQuery, and Spanner. Is there something I missed ? Update : I am using Spark 3. Now, rename your JSON credentials file to gcp-credentials. Spark, one of our favorite email apps for iPhone and iPad, has made the jump to Mac. BigQuery DataSource V1 Shaded Distributable For Scala 2 License0 bigdata google query bigquery cloud spark dependencies #27858 in MvnRepository ( See Top Artifacts) Used By BigQuery DataSource V1 For Scala 2 License0 bigdata google query bigquery cloud spark #283557 in MvnRepository ( See Top Artifacts) Used By May 5, 2023 · GoogleCloudDataproc / spark-bigquery-connector Public. top 10 best midsize suv Expert Advice On Improving Your. The Spark connector for BigQuery eliminates the need to export data from BigQuery to Google Cloud Storage, improving data processing times. To install the BiqQuery connector, complete the following steps. This Spark module allows saving DataFrame as BigQuery table. Caused by: comcloudbigquerycomcloudBigQueryException: Inserted row has wrong column count; Has 2, expected 1 at [4:30] The data I'm trying to write has one additional column (called array_field -- its type is string , the name is misleading) as compared to the target BigQuery table, where its schema. If you see the below logs, its able to identify the schema of the table and after that it waited for 8. Code; Issues 23; Pull requests 6; Actions; Projects 0; Security; Insights New issue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and. show () fails) #225 Closed informatica92 opened this issue on Jul 31, 2020 · 15 comments informatica92 commented on Jul 31, 2020 • I'm writing a Spark job in Scala on Google DataProc that executes daily and processes records each marked with a transaction time. We use the Google BigQuery Spark Connector to import data stored in Parquet files into BigQuery. But when I submit my code to google cloud using gcloud dataproc jobs submit spark I got an exc. By default, Integration Connectors allocates 2 nodes (for better availability) for a connection. Jun 7, 2017 · Running a Spark job in Google Cloud Dataproc. man stabbed reddit The file in spark-bigquery-with-dependencies jar have scalaversion property in it others does not have the property defined. Parent project (parentProject): The ID for the parent project, which is the Google Cloud Project ID to bill for reading and writing. py with touch wordcount. NGK Spark Plug News: This is the News-site for the company NGK Spark Plug on Markets Insider Indices Commodities Currencies Stocks The iPhone email app game has changed a lot over the years, with the only constant being that no app seems to remain consistently at the top. Cumbers has an ongoing window into the future of synthetic biology. Indirect is slower due to the nature of operation. Custom Connector - AWS Glue for latest version of spark-bigquery connector #996 opened on Jun 13, 2023 by kaa125 3 When using the connector with Spark 30 (on Java 11), trying to read a dataset from BigQuery fails with the error at the bottom. Here is my code: spark = SparkSessionappName("test") I have create a client id and client secret for my bigquery project, but I don't know how to use those to successfully save a dataframe from a pyspark script to my bigquery table GoogleCloudDataproc / spark-bigquery-connector Public Notifications Fork 189 Star 358 196 Apr 19, 2023 at 19:57 apache-spark pyspark google-bigquery google-cloud-storage spark-bigquery-connector 2,986 Feb 21, 2023 at 16:16 apache-spark spark-bigquery-connector 24 Jan 25, 2023 at 18:22 apache-spark pyspark google-bigquery spark-bigquery-connector 39 Jan 21, 2023 at 21:28 json pyspark google-bigquery apache-spark-sql spark. Join BigQuery and BigLake tables with Hive tables. More information is needed to assess whether there is a problem with the connector. Every fall, San Francisco fills with a volatile cocktail of venture capit. While a variety of applications have built-in connectors to BigQuery, many enterprises still have difficulty establishing connectivity between BigQuery and BI tools like Power BI The Simba ODBC driver typically allows much more granular configuration options than BI. Connectors initialization action now supports Spark BigQuery connector, and can be used to install Spark BigQuery connector on Dataproc cluster during cluster creation: REGION=. py with touch wordcount. Viewed 561 times Part of Google Cloud Collective 1 I am trying to write unit test case for my spark bigquery implementation. A spark plug is an electrical component of a cylinder head in an internal combustion engine. Jan 20, 2022 · Spark BigQuery Connector Common Library License: Apache 2.
Post Opinion
Like
What Girls & Guys Said
Opinion
47Opinion
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. \n; PR #857: Fixing autovalue shaded classes repackaging \n; BigQuery API has been upgraded to version 20 \n; BigQuery Storage API has been upgraded to version 20 \n Oct 27, 2023 · Benefits of Google BigQuery Spark connector. bigquery (take the spark-bigquery-with-dependencies artifact - David Rabinowitz. \n
The BigQuery Query API is more expensive than the BigQuery Storage API. Databricks is using a fork of the open-source Google Spark Connector for BigQuery. option("temporaryGcsBucket", "bq_temporary_folder&quo. properties in both jars. A spark plug is an electrical component of a cylinder head in an internal combustion engine. bling nails This is the version of Java that works OK with BigQuery and spark. Direct write of large datasets may need to update the quota of concurrent write streams. Sep 11, 2023 · I am trying to use the spark-bigquery connector in a notebook using the spark kernel in a dataproc user-mananaged notebook. Follow answered Jun 26, 2019 at 9:38 846 2 2 gold. An FDD connector is a pin ribbon connector that connects a floppy disk drive with the computer’s motherboard. reeds jewelry Additional information. option('table', bq_dataset + bq_table) \ createOrReplaceTempView('bqdf') Jul 15, 2021 · We are using spark-bigquery-connector to pull the data from BigQuery using Spark. As of now error's in bigquery (ex: table does not exists or permission issues) will not make the spark application exit or stop. Jun 10, 2020 · spark-bigquery-connector. food truck for sale savannah ga Direct write of large datasets may need to update the quota of concurrent write streams. BQ Connector: spark-bigquery-with-dependencies_22740. But the only JDBC driver I found starschema is old The pom. Issue with Spark Big Query Connector with Java How to install spark-bigquery-connector in the VM GCP? Ask Question Asked 3 years, 7 months ago. option('table', table_name). 5-bigquery aimed to be used in Spark 3 This connector implements new APIs and capabilities provided by the Spark Data Source V2 API. Notifications You must be signed in to change notification settings; Fork 190; Star 353.
Hi, I am doing some test arround the new spark24 version of the connector, unfortunately I have some issue. 0: Tags: bigdata google query bigquery cloud spark connector connection: Date: Jan 20, 2022: Files: I'm using the BigQuery Spark connector (version 00) to create a clustered table in BigQuery, specifically in direct write mode. Step 4: Writing Data to BigQuery. Update. We tried to exclude slf4j dependency from arrow-vector , build it and try customized jar. Mar 4, 2021 · GoogleCloudDataproc / spark-bigquery-connector Public. Flakey behavior when writing to BigQuery #1131 Closed imrimt opened this issue on Nov 20, 2023 · 2 comments davidrabinowitz commented on Jul 31, 2023 Unfortunately two connectors cannot co-exist in the Spark runtime. USB cables and connectors have come a long way since their inception. Apache Spark is a distributed processing framework and programming model that helps you do machine learning, stream processing, or graph analytics. Note that to run the following steps, you must have Confluent Platform running locally. I have encoded my gcloud credentials service json file to Base64 from the command-line and am simply pasting the string for the credentials options. These sleek, understated timepieces have become a fashion statement for many, and it’s no c. Flakey behavior when writing to BigQuery #1131 Closed imrimt opened this issue on Nov 20, 2023 · 2 comments davidrabinowitz commented on Jul 31, 2023 Unfortunately two connectors cannot co-exist in the Spark runtime. Hot Network Questions How to delete an island whose min x less than -1 4. This is how it's recommended: # Saving the data to BigQuery word_countformat('bigquery') \. sql import SparkSession spark = SparkSessionappName("GCS to @PjoterS Well, there is a way I can use api libraries to execute sql, but I want is to use sparkbigquery connector and execute the sql. @mamdouhweb if you are setting --service-account in Dataproc it does not mean that you need to set googleauthaccountcloudservicejson. I used Google APIs Client Library for Java. Garden hose connectors — also known as hose fittings — are a key component of any lawn or garden watering system. Direct write of large datasets may need to update the quota of concurrent write streams. look who got busted muskegon county Without them, it would be nearly impossible to build or service a car. Using Java MapReduce. # by the InputFormat. latestRevision libraryDependencies ++= Seq ( "orgspark. Garden hose connectors — also known as hose fittings — are a key component of any lawn or garden watering system. Spark BigQuery Connector Common Library License: Apache 2. Now, I happened to be using the spark/DataProc job to rewrite a whole table so if I have the wrong semantics, that's on me and it's WAI. Thereafter create three dataframes and then. gcloud dataproc clusters create clusterName --bucket bucketName --region europe-west3 --zone europe-west3-a --master-machine-type n1-standard-16 --master-boot-disk-type pd-ssd --master-boot-disk-size 200 --num-workers 2 --worker-machine-type n1. The Storage API streams data in parallel directly from BigQuery via gRPC without using Google Cloud Storage as an. Unfortunately there is no workaround this (unless you are using BigQuery's query API, but then you are limited into a single thread read. To configure the BigQuery connector, create a catalog properties file in etc/catalog named example. Apache Spark SQL connector for Google BigQuery The connector supports reading Google BigQuery tables into Spark's DataFrames, and writing DataFrames back into BigQuery. Notifications You must be signed in to change notification settings; Fork 190; Star 353. I can't speak to the details of the BigQuery spark connector, but the normal reason this happens is to parallelize the data transfer. In this codelab you will use the spark-bigquery-connector for reading and writing data between BigQuery and Spark Creating a Project Sign in to Google Cloud Platform console at consolegoogle. run 3 66ez This means that while writing and reading of maps is available, running a SQL on BigQuery that uses map semantics is not supported. Console. The Spark connector for BigQuery eliminates the need to export data from BigQuery to Google Cloud Storage, improving data processing times. For reading regular tables there's no need for bigquerycreate permission. Mar 4, 2021 · GoogleCloudDataproc / spark-bigquery-connector Public. When specifying a temporary bucket for writing to BQ the spark-bigquery-connector relies on the GCS connector to make requests to GCS (including verifying that this temporary bucket exists). The same connector library can be used to write data back to BigQuery. 4 added the parameterized SQL query support so maybe that is the path forward, but for the time being I'm stuck with Spark 3 Please, please tell me there's a better way than String. Dec 6, 2019 · Credentials can also be provided explicitly either as a parameter or from Spark runtime configuration. [This solution is specifically for SIMBA driver]. Read from BigQuery in Spark 3. Provide details and share your research! But avoid …. Using the bigquery java client gets me the results back in about 2 seconds. Maybe you've tried this game of biting down on a wintergreen candy in the dark and looking in the mirror and seeing a spark. After trying this, i got an InvalidSchemaException with the message Destination table's schema. StatusRuntimeException Issue with Spark Big Query Connector with Java Bigquery as metastore for Dataproc. It supports "direct" import/export where records are directly streamed from/to BigQuery. Notifications You must be signed in to change notification settings; Fork 189; Star 358. Have you ever found yourself staring at a blank page, unsure of where to begin? Whether you’re a writer, artist, or designer, the struggle to find inspiration can be all too real Young Adult (YA) novels have become a powerful force in literature, captivating readers of all ages with their compelling stories and relatable characters. Step 1: Providing the Spark BigQuery Connector to your Application. The project was inspired by spotify/spark-bigquery, but there are several differences: JSON is used as an intermediate format instead of Avro. The Google Cloud team has created the set of connectors to access the data in GCP.